What's considered a gentle boil?
            Online Answer
            
                
                    
                        
                
            
        
    
                            A simmer (top left) is identified by pockets of fine but constant bubbling that give off occasional wisps of steam. ... A vigorous simmer/gentle boil is indicated by more constant small bubbles breaking the surface of the liquid, with frequent wisps of steam, and by larger bubbles beginning to rise..

                            A vigorous simmer/gentle boil is indicated by more constant small bubbles breaking the surface of the liquid, with frequent wisps of steam, and by larger bubbles beginning to rise. ... A boil occurs when large bubbles come from the bottom of the pot and quickly rise to the surface, producing constant steam..

                            What does a simmer look like? To most easily gauge a simmer, simply watch the amount of bubbles rising from the bottom of the pot to the surface of your liquid. At a low simmer the liquid will have minimal movement with only a few, tiny bubbles rising intermittently, accompanied by little wisps of steam..
